Berlin born Helene is a composer and theater maker from Berlin. She is currently working on own theater, music and movement research.
She holds a Bachelor from the World Music Academy in Rotterdam and a Master in ‘Improvised Music for Vocals’, Bruckner University Linz.
Helene studied theater and dance at the AHK (Amsterdam), PSA (Paris) and with Cedric Charron (Jan Fabre), Arthur Rosenfeld (Pina Bausch) and Tal Sofer.
She has been making performative pieces amongst others with Sali Betinzane (Syria/ Austria), MAAS Theatre Company Rotterdam (Arthur Rosenfeld), LICHTBENDE Contemporary Visual Theatre Company Amsterdam (Rob Logister/ Marie Raemakers), ORIAN Dance Company Paris (Mehdi Farajour), De Stilte – Breda.
As a theatre performer she joined the national tour of Senf Theatre’s production “Here, There and Everywhere” in 2010. In 2012 Helene joined MAAS Theater and Dance Company and The Lichtbende Theatre Company, collaborates and performs with them on a regular basis. From 2015-2016 she has been a member of the cast in Stomp, Ambassadors Theatre – London.
Helene has worked as a composer for the productions ‘Crimson Soil’ (Sali Betinzane), ‘Wild Thing’ MAAS Theatre Company (the Netherlands), “TUTU” Lichtbende Projection Theatre and the musical ensembles Ot Azoj, Nelson Faria (Brazil) and others.
With the band Zulemax, Helene performed at Montreux Jazz Festival (2014) in Switzerland and she’s recorded “Zulemax llegó” (2012), with original composition arranged by Cuban Grammy Award holder Joaquin Betancourt.
In 2011 she founded the NGO World Music Factory leading projects and education programs in Viña del Mar, Constitución, Licantén and Santiago, Chile and the community of Darling, South Africa.
Helene is a world citizen, having mastered various styles of theater performance & music and is speaking six different languages fluently.
